THE INN ASSISTANT

Niels Fiil

1920 – 1944
 
Niels Fiil was the son of Marius and Gudrun Fiil. Right from being very young, Niels helped his parents to run the inn and its farm. The idea was that Niels would take over both. He returned home on 1 April 1943 from the Ladelund Agricultural College and joined the drop site group Marius was forming based in Hvidsten and Spentrup.
 
Niels took part in the group's operations receiving parachutists, weapons and explosives at the Mustard Point drop site. He was also involved in helping illegal refugees and wanted persons. When drops were suspended due to German interest in the area in the autumn of 1943, Niels and his friend and co-member of the group, Johan Kjær Hansen went to Aalborg to learn how to make hand grenades.
 
Niels was arrested by the Gestapo on 11 March 1944. He was sentenced to death by a military tribunal on 26 June 1944.
